Beside above, does thickness of vinyl flooring matter?
The overall thickness of your vinyl floor is generally a less important specification, since it has little to do with durability (the wear-layer thickness is what determines how long the floor will last). That said, overall “nominal” thickness does matter in one specific case: Click flooring.
What is a good wear layer for vinyl plank flooring?
In short, the thicker the wear layer, the more durable the floor. If you have a space that will need a high resistance to scratches and wear, a higher wear layer, such as a 12 mil or 20 mil, would be best for your application. Commercial vinyl flooring applications will usually require a 20 mil top layer.
What are the disadvantages of vinyl flooring?
Some disadvantages of vinyl flooring include:- Cannot be repaired.
- Can emit volatile organic compounds (VOCs)
- Shorter lifespan than wood floors.
- No impact, or negative impact, on home resale value.
- Difficult to remove, especially if adhesive is used during installation.
- Not eco-friendly; difficult to recycle.
Do you need underlay for vinyl?
Underlay. Most vinyl floors don't need an underlay. If the surface you're laying on is level and smooth, a well-cushioned vinyl floor should be fine on its own.
